Is Bill Belichick a big sissy?

A lot is being made of how he ran off the field with one second left on the clock.

Personally I don't care where little Bill goes to cry. I'm a happy Giants fan. My dad's a happy Giants fan. My friends are happy Giants fans...

A few things are changing for Giants fans now. We are probably done criticsing Eli Manning who I must say took all the criticism New York could throw his way like a real man.

We can now make fun of Tiki Barber, probably the greatest Giants running back ever. Too bad he turned into an ass and had to go criticizing his former teammates and coaches. Guess he has to shut up now.

David Tyree should see the field more as a receiver. Sure he never made too much noise in the regular season but the guy is clutch. This story has a sweet picture of his amazing catch.

Other Giants came up huge as well. David Diehl is still playing awesome at left tackle and who thinks Justin Tuck could have been named MVP?

Of course, some people still don't give the Giants enough credit. Although they do mention the "Giants furious pass rush" they blame this loss on Tom Brady's below average performace. I don't like that. Tom Brady gave his best and our defense was often better.

And that's really the end of the story. We won a New York Giants style football game. Gotta love tough defense!
